湿法磷酸脱氟渣中磷和氟的浸取回收  被引量:1

Recovery of phosphorus and fluorine in defluorination sludge from wet-process phosphoric acid by leaching

摘  要:脱氟渣是湿法磷酸在脱氟过程中产生的废渣,其中含有价值的磷、氟。为回收脱氟渣的磷,研究了浸取法分离脱氟渣中磷、氟的工艺。分别以水、碳酸钠溶液作为浸取剂,考察了不同的浸取时间、pH值、温度、液固比及2级浸取条件下,脱氟渣中P2O5、F的浸出率和浸出液的磷氟比(P2O5/F)。结果表明:在水浸取体系,适宜的条件是浸取时间为30min、液固比为2∶1、温度为30℃,P2O5和F的浸出率分别为92.38%、11.56%,浸出液的P2O5/F为9.54;在碱浸取体系,适宜的条件是浸取时间为30min,液固比为3∶1、pH值为3.8、温度为25℃,P2O5和F的浸出率分别为75.68%、1.49%,P2O5/F为61.36;二级浸取能减少浸取剂的用量,并有效地降低F的浸出率。将水浸出液浓缩能有效地提高P2O5/F,可以得到饲料级MCP生产所需的磷酸。Defluorination sludge is the waste generated from the defluorination process of wet-process phosphoric acid;it contains valuable phosphorus and fluorine resources.In order to recycle the phosphorus resources,separation process of phosphorus and fluorine in defluorination sludge by leaching method was studied.The leaching ratio of P2O5 and F in defluorination sludge and the phosphor-fluorine ratio(P2O5/F)of the leaching solution were investigated under different leaching time,pH,temperature and liquid-solid ratio choosing water and sodium carbonate solution as the leaching agents respectively.The results showed that the optimal conditions were as follows:leaching time is 30 min,liquid-solid ratio is 2∶1,temperature is 30℃,the leaching ratio of P2O5 and F are 92.38%and 11.56%respectively,and the P2O5/F of leaching solution is 9.54.For the alkali system,the optimal conditions were determined at leaching time of 30 min,liquid-solid ratio of 3∶1,pH of 3.8,temperature of 25℃,the leaching ratio of P2O5 and F are 75.68%and 1.49%respectively,and the P2O5/F of the leaching solution is 61.36.The two-stage leaching can reduce the amount of leaching agents and the leaching ratio of F.The P2O5/F can be effectively increased by condensing water leaching solution to get the phosphoric acid that required for the feed-grade calcium dihydrogen phosphate(MCP).
